Anglers Tavern, Maribyrnong

Angler’s Tavern is a pub located on the Maribrynong river in Melbourne’s West had a makeover and my work decided to have a function there (woohoo!). The big boss got the private room with the three course meal which was pretty fancyyyy. The view was fantabulous (well, as fantabulous as the Maribyrnong could be) and the staff were awesomely friendly. While having drinkies, the staff had placed a meat/cheese/dip platter for nibbles and this was very enjoyable. I nibbled away all night on these until my food came out.

My absolutely favourite part was the bread. It was amazingly soft, smells divine and it was buttery and sweet already. It was like eating a buttery cloud and I couldn’t get enough of it.

I had the cajun chicken medallions and this was very dry. The couscous was a touch on the bland side as well. The mint yoghurt complemented the chicken nicely but the yoghurt:chicken ratio was way off. Be a bit more generous with the mint yoghurt guys.

Cajun Chicken Medallions
with roasted vegetable couscous & mint yoghurt

I also had chicken for my main (chicken again?) and yes, the breast was also dry. There wasn’t a lot of chorizo stuffed inside the breast and everything was a touch on the bland side and it required A LOT of salt and pepper to bring out any flavour at all.

Roast Chicken Breast
Stuffed with chorizo & boccocini served with sweet potato and pesto cream

My workmate had the Black Angus Scotch and this wasn’t too bad. They said it was going to be medium rare, it came out well done It was a touch on the touch side but I preferred this over the chicken breast.

300gm Black Angus Scotch
with house cut chips & mushroom gravy

Finally, dessert came out and it was the good ol’ sticky date pudding. You can never go wrong with this dessert and yep, this was pretty darn good. Although, they did say it was going to have fresh strawberries and I found only one strawberry sitting there.

Sticky Date Pudding
with Vanilla bean ice cream & fresh strawberries

Angler’s Tavern new interior and exterior is beautiful and is a perfect place to grab a beer with a great view. Come for drinks but don’t stay for the food because everything was either dry or quite bland. Sorry Angler’s Tavern but looks doesn’t do it for me anymore, you’ve got to have personality too.
